diff --git a/translations/conf/multicompress/conf_et.ts b/translations/conf/multicompress/conf_et.ts
new file mode 100644
index 000000000..89c79d7b3
--- /dev/null
+++ b/translations/conf/multicompress/conf_et.ts
@@ -0,0 +1,20 @@
+
+
+ desktop
+
+
+ Add to "%d.7z"
+ Lis %d.7z'isse
+
+
+
+ Add to "%d.zip"
+ Lis %d.zip'isse
+
+
+
+ Compress
+ Kompandire
+
+
+
\ No newline at end of file
diff --git a/translations/conf/multicompress/conf_ne.ts b/translations/conf/multicompress/conf_ne.ts
new file mode 100644
index 000000000..ee977a7e4
--- /dev/null
+++ b/translations/conf/multicompress/conf_ne.ts
@@ -0,0 +1,20 @@
+
+
+ desktop
+
+
+ Add to "%d.7z"
+ %d. 7z मा वास्तविक गर्नुहोस्
+
+
+
+ Add to "%d.zip"
+ %d.zip मा वास्तविक गर्नुहोस्
+
+
+
+ Compress
+ संपीडन गर्नुहोस्
+
+
+
\ No newline at end of file
diff --git a/translations/conf/multicompress/conf_vi.ts b/translations/conf/multicompress/conf_vi.ts
new file mode 100644
index 000000000..c8c42fa6b
--- /dev/null
+++ b/translations/conf/multicompress/conf_vi.ts
@@ -0,0 +1,20 @@
+
+
+ desktop
+
+
+ Add to "%d.7z"
+ Thêm vào "%d.7z"
+
+
+
+ Add to "%d.zip"
+ Thêm vào "%d.zip"
+
+
+
+ Compress
+ Nén
+
+
+
\ No newline at end of file
diff --git a/translations/conf/multiextract/conf_et.ts b/translations/conf/multiextract/conf_et.ts
index d350877aa..29c167c51 100644
--- a/translations/conf/multiextract/conf_et.ts
+++ b/translations/conf/multiextract/conf_et.ts
@@ -14,7 +14,7 @@
Extract to %d
-
+ %d pakkumine
\ No newline at end of file
diff --git a/translations/conf/multiextract/conf_ne.ts b/translations/conf/multiextract/conf_ne.ts
new file mode 100644
index 000000000..63c6952da
--- /dev/null
+++ b/translations/conf/multiextract/conf_ne.ts
@@ -0,0 +1,20 @@
+
+
+ desktop
+
+
+ Extract
+ बाहिर गर्न
+
+
+
+ Extract here
+ यी यस्तै बाहिर गर्न
+
+
+
+ Extract to %d
+ %d भए बाहिर गर्न
+
+
+
\ No newline at end of file
diff --git a/translations/conf/multiextract/conf_vi.ts b/translations/conf/multiextract/conf_vi.ts
new file mode 100644
index 000000000..8f905518d
--- /dev/null
+++ b/translations/conf/multiextract/conf_vi.ts
@@ -0,0 +1,20 @@
+
+
+ desktop
+
+
+ Extract
+ Rút gọn
+
+
+
+ Extract here
+ Rút gọn tại đây
+
+
+
+ Extract to %d
+ Rút gọn đến %d
+
+
+
\ No newline at end of file
diff --git a/translations/conf/singlecompress/conf_et.ts b/translations/conf/singlecompress/conf_et.ts
new file mode 100644
index 000000000..37d0537b1
--- /dev/null
+++ b/translations/conf/singlecompress/conf_et.ts
@@ -0,0 +1,20 @@
+
+
+ desktop
+
+
+ Add to "%b.7z"
+ Lis %b.7z'isse
+
+
+
+ Add to "%b.zip"
+ Lis %b.zip'isse
+
+
+
+ Compress
+ Komprimi
+
+
+
\ No newline at end of file
diff --git a/translations/conf/singlecompress/conf_ne.ts b/translations/conf/singlecompress/conf_ne.ts
new file mode 100644
index 000000000..e05b83e78
--- /dev/null
+++ b/translations/conf/singlecompress/conf_ne.ts
@@ -0,0 +1,20 @@
+
+
+ desktop
+
+
+ Add to "%b.7z"
+ %b.7z भएको विश्लेषण गर्नुहोस्
+
+
+
+ Add to "%b.zip"
+ %b.zip भएको विश्लेषण गर्नुहोस्
+
+
+
+ Compress
+ विश्लेषण गर्नुहोस्
+
+
+
\ No newline at end of file
diff --git a/translations/conf/singlecompress/conf_vi.ts b/translations/conf/singlecompress/conf_vi.ts
new file mode 100644
index 000000000..5afc4077c
--- /dev/null
+++ b/translations/conf/singlecompress/conf_vi.ts
@@ -0,0 +1,20 @@
+
+
+ desktop
+
+
+ Add to "%b.7z"
+ Thêm vào "%b.7z"
+
+
+
+ Add to "%b.zip"
+ Thêm vào "%b.zip"
+
+
+
+ Compress
+ Sжжтсн
+
+
+
\ No newline at end of file
diff --git a/translations/conf/singleextract/conf_et.ts b/translations/conf/singleextract/conf_et.ts
index 48e796230..4bec1ecce 100644
--- a/translations/conf/singleextract/conf_et.ts
+++ b/translations/conf/singleextract/conf_et.ts
@@ -14,7 +14,7 @@
Extract to %b
-
+ %b eemalda
\ No newline at end of file
diff --git a/translations/conf/singleextract/conf_ne.ts b/translations/conf/singleextract/conf_ne.ts
new file mode 100644
index 000000000..0c8574099
--- /dev/null
+++ b/translations/conf/singleextract/conf_ne.ts
@@ -0,0 +1,20 @@
+
+
+ desktop
+
+
+ Extract
+ यस्तावना तयार गर्नुहोस्
+
+
+
+ Extract here
+ यो पानीले तयार गर्नुहोस्
+
+
+
+ Extract to %b
+ %bमा यस्तावना तयार गर्नुहोस्
+
+
+
\ No newline at end of file
diff --git a/translations/conf/singleextract/conf_vi.ts b/translations/conf/singleextract/conf_vi.ts
new file mode 100644
index 000000000..f2ba2ccf2
--- /dev/null
+++ b/translations/conf/singleextract/conf_vi.ts
@@ -0,0 +1,20 @@
+
+
+ desktop
+
+
+ Extract
+ Xuất
+
+
+
+ Extract here
+ Xuất tại đây
+
+
+
+ Extract to %b
+ Xuất đến %b
+
+
+
\ No newline at end of file
diff --git a/translations/deepin-compressor_sq.ts b/translations/deepin-compressor_sq.ts
index 5fbf3f8ca..d513b9adc 100644
--- a/translations/deepin-compressor_sq.ts
+++ b/translations/deepin-compressor_sq.ts
@@ -86,7 +86,7 @@
CPU threads
-
+ Filat CPU
@@ -142,22 +142,22 @@
Single thread
-
+ Filat e poënë
2 threads
-
+ 2 filat
4 threads
-
+ 4 filat
8 threads
-
+ 8 filat
diff --git a/translations/desktop/desktop_et.ts b/translations/desktop/desktop_et.ts
index 3926cb4f8..50a96062a 100644
--- a/translations/desktop/desktop_et.ts
+++ b/translations/desktop/desktop_et.ts
@@ -1 +1 @@
-desktopArchive ManagerArhiivihaldurDeepin Archive ManagerDeepin arhiivihaldurWork with file archivescompress;extract;deepin;
\ No newline at end of file
+desktopArchive ManagerArhiivihaldurDeepin Archive ManagerDeepin arhiivihaldurWork with file archivesFaili pakkudega töölecompress;extract;deepin;kompreesioon;vaatsing;deepin
\ No newline at end of file
diff --git a/translations/desktop/desktop_vi.ts b/translations/desktop/desktop_vi.ts
new file mode 100644
index 000000000..08c1831de
--- /dev/null
+++ b/translations/desktop/desktop_vi.ts
@@ -0,0 +1 @@
+desktopArchive ManagerQuản lý thư mục lưu trữDeepin Archive ManagerQuản lý thư mục lưu trữ DeepinWork with file archivesLàm việc với thư mục lưu trữ filecompress;extract;deepin;nén; rút gọn; deepin
\ No newline at end of file